Transaction 6830a2ec3f79efaf0906a5c3ce99e562dd7941701656409ffa2b66f4638125b6

23 Input
2 Outputs
  • 6830a2ec3f79efaf0906a5c3ce99e562dd7941701656409ffa2b66f4638125b6:0
  • value  956951
    address  3GvberzDXNW22LTq3r71zuYntrT8Divk2i
  • 6830a2ec3f79efaf0906a5c3ce99e562dd7941701656409ffa2b66f4638125b6:1
  • value  556854679
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s